The Python string expandtabs() method returns a copy of the string in tab characters ie. '\t' are expanded making use of spaces, or optionally making use of the given tabsize (default value is 8).

Syntax
The following below is the syntax for the Python String expandtabs() method -
str.expandtabs(tabsize = 8 )

Parameter Details
- tabsize - It specifies the number of characters to be replaced for a tab character '\t'.
Return Value
This returns a copy of the string in tabs character ie., '\t' have been expanded using spaces.
Example
The following below is a simple example -
#!/usr/bin/python str = "this is\tstring example....wow!!!"; print "Original string: " + str print "Defualt exapanded tab: " + str.expandtabs() print "Double exapanded tab: " + str.expandtabs(16)
Output
Below is the output of the above example -
Original string: this is string example....wow!!! Defualt exapanded tab: this is string example....wow!!! Double exapanded tab: this is string example....wow!!!
